    Thor Odinson is the All-father of Asgard /God of Thunder, offspring of All-Father Odin & Elder-Goddess Gaea. Combining the powers of both realms makes him an elder-god hybrid and a being of no perceivable limits. Armed with his enchanted Uru hammer Mjolnir which helps him to channel his godly energies. The mightiest and the most beloved warrior in all of Asgard, a staunch ally for good and one of the most powerful beings in the multiverse/omniverse. Thor is also a founding member of the Avengers.

    In Thor 310, Thor is taken to Mephisto's realm and fights him to a draw with Mephisto admitting he can't beat Thor in his own domain so that he is forced to free some humans he had taken there before they had died. I just read it recently but had never seen this battle mentioned before.
